Hva er et klientservernettverk?

Høyvinkelvisning av unge dataprogrammerere som koder på bærbare datamaskiner ved skrivebordet på et lite kontor

Hva er et klientservernettverk?

Bildekreditt: Maskot/Maskot/GettyImages

Ettersom teknologi og datamaskiner har fortsatt å utvikle seg raskt, har et klientservernettverk snart erstattet tidligere former for nettverk på en datamaskin for å bli det mest brukte. Et klientservernettverk kan brukes av stasjonære datamaskiner og bærbare datamaskiner, så vel som andre mobile enheter som er riktig utstyrt.

Tips

Et klientservernettverk er et hvor flere datamaskiner – klientene – kobles til en sentral datamaskin som fungerer som en server. Denne typen nettverksmodell lar enheter enkelt få tilgang til informasjon som deles fra serveren.

Definer klientservernettverk

Et klientservernettverk er definert som en spesifikk type nettnettverk som består av en enkelt sentral datamaskin som fungerer som en server som dirigerer flere andre datamaskiner, som omtales som klientene. Ved å få tilgang til serveren kan klienter nå delte filer og informasjon som er lagret på serveringsdatamaskinen. Videre er klientservernettverk svært like i naturen til peer-to-peer-nettverk med unntak av at det bare er serveren som kan starte en bestemt transaksjon.

Dagens video

Funksjoner i klientservernettverk

En klientservermodell kan implementeres i et enkelt datasystem, men brukes oftest over mange forskjellige nettsteder. Dette gjør det mulig for flere datamaskiner eller personer å koble sammen og dele informasjon.

Ettersom virksomheter utvider seg og folk nå jobber sammen over store avstander, gjør en klientservermodell dem i stand til å nå en felles, eller delt, database eller program. Dette fungerer også når nettbaserte brukere får tilgang til bankkontoen sin eller betaler bestemte regninger på nettet. Brukere logger på bankens server med sine spørsmål, og deretter fortsetter serveren med å videresende informasjonen deres.

Fordeler med klientservernettverk

Hovedfordelene med klientservernettverket er å tillate tilgang til eller oppdatering av en delt database eller et nettsted av flere datamaskiner, samtidig som det kun opprettholdes ett kontrollsenter for handlingen. Dette gjør det mulig for bedrifter å distribuere informasjon, laste opp data eller nå programmet uten å være bundet til én enkelt datamaskinside. Fordi informasjonen er lagret online, oppretter en klientservermodell mer makt og kontroll over hva som blir lagret.

I tillegg har denne modellen en økt sikkerhet, ofte med kryptering, noe som sikrer at dataene kun er tilgjengelige for kvalifiserte personer. En klientservermodell gjør det også enklere å sikkerhetskopiere viktig informasjon enn om den var lagret på flere enheter. En nettverksadministrator kan ganske enkelt konfigurere en sikkerhetskopi for serveren, og hvis de originale dataene skulle bli ødelagt, trenger han eller hun bare å gjenopprette den enkelt sikkerhetskopien.

Ulemper med klientservernettverk

Under en klientservermodell er den største ulempen å kjøre risiko for overbelastning av systemet på grunn av ikke å ha nok ressurser til å betjene alle klientene. Hvis for mange forskjellige klienter forsøker å nå det delte nettverket samtidig, kan det oppstå en feil eller en senking av tilkoblingen. Videre, hvis nettverket er nede, deaktiverer dette tilgang til informasjonen fra ethvert nettsted eller klient hvor som helst. Dette kan være skadelig for store virksomheter som ikke klarer å nå sine relevante data.

Andre nettverksmodeller å vurdere

Andre typer tjenesteforbindelser inkluderer master slave-nettverk og peer-to-peer-nettverk. I et master-slave-diagram er et enkelt program ansvarlig for alle de andre, hvor det ene er dominerende over det andre. Denne nettverkstypen gjør det lettere å oppdage hvor data kommer fra og går til. I motsetning til dette skiller et peer-to-peer-nettverk, selv om det ligner på en klient-server-arkitektur, ved at det lar enhver klient starte transaksjoner. Denne typen nettverk kommer med flere utfordringer for administratorer siden det er vanskeligere å sikkerhetskopiere data og administrere brukere.